Handover — Birchvale greenhouse controller. The east-bay humidity sensors drift roughly +2% per week; the controller compensates via the weekly recalibration job, so don't trust raw readings mid-cycle. If drift exceeds 5%, swap the probe rather than re-tuning. Recalibration history and the probe replacement procedure are documented on the internal page below.

runbook for tajep-yahig: https://artifactory.lumictech.corp/repo

Handover — Vexler partner SFTP drop

Ownership moves to you today. Drop runs hourly from Vexler's end into the intake bucket via the relay host. Watch for zero-byte files; their exporter flakes on Mondays. Creds live in the ops vault, path noted in the runbook. Vault auto-seals after 48h idle. Support escalations go to the on-call rotation, not me. If the vault is sealed when you need it, unseal with the recovery passphrase below.

recovery phrase for tadug-fafof: zorwyn-kasion

## Account Recovery — ScanBridge Integration

Applies to the ScanBridge barcode scanner service account only. Symptoms: scans queue locally, sync endpoint returns auth failures. Steps: confirm device clock drift under 30s. Revoke stale tokens via admin CLI. Re-pair the scanner fleet; do not factory-reset units. If the service account itself is locked, recovery requires the vault. Unseal it with the passphrase below.

unlock words, fafop-hawep: briwyn-oliix-sorox

# Quick setup notes for the Tailhound CLI client.
# Tailhound streams logs from the internal aggregator — super handy for
# following a deploy in real time without poking around in dashboards.
# First run creates ~/.tailhound/config and you'll paste a credential in
# when prompted. Don't commit that file, obviously. Staging and prod use
# separate keys, and you only need staging to start. For staging, use the
# key below.

API key for tajog-bajof: kto15_6fvgvYZbOKdLifh

Checklist item 4 — Payslip run to Aldmere Yard

Aldmere Yard has no printer on site, so collect the sealed payslip envelopes from the records office before departure. Confirm the count against the staff list, place them in the locked document case, and log the case number on the run sheet. The courier hand-over must follow this instruction:

handover note for bajog-tawig: the lamion quenael courier leaves the wendor ledger at gate 1289 under passcode 760784